Copper is an important cofactor for enzymes involved in: Collagen cross-linking Antioxidant defense Wound repair Extracellular matrix remodeling GHK-Cu appears to support: Collagen synthesis Elastin production Glycosaminoglycan production Angiogenesis Antioxidant activity Matrix metalloproteinase regulation Why GHK-Cu is popular in aesthetics: GHK-Cu is commonly discussed in skin rejuvenation because it may support skin thickness, elasticity, firmness, wound repair, hair follicle signaling, reduced inflammation, and improved skin texture
